Feds Kindly Seize Buildings from Secret Iranian Foundation
Photo: Courtesy NY Daily News
Federal agents have begun the process of seizing a Fifth Avenue skyscraper and a Queens mosque from a Muslim nonprofit secretly run by the Iranian government. The Alavi Foundation owns 60 percent of the Piaget building at 650 Fifth Avenue, which was valued at $650 million in 2007. According to a Manhattan US Attorney, the foundation has been secretly controlled by a series of Iranian ambassadors to the U.N. for the past 20 years. The Imam Ali Mosque in Woodside, Queens, is the Feds's other area target. They're also going after properties in California, Maryland, Virginia and Texas. [NYDN]
